Overview of the Facility

Millcreek Township Police Jail is a short-term holding facility located in Erie County, Pennsylvania. It primarily serves as a temporary detention center for individuals arrested by the Millcreek Township Police Department.

How to Locate an Inmate

To locate an inmate at Millcreek Township Police Jail, contact the facility directly using the phone number provided above. Due to the short-term nature of this facility, inmates are typically transferred to Erie County Prison for longer stays.

Visitation Information

As this is a temporary holding facility, visitation is generally not permitted. Individuals are usually transferred to Erie County Prison for longer-term detention, where visitation policies are in place.

Booking and Release Process

Individuals arrested by Millcreek Township Police are booked into this facility. They may be released on bail or transferred to Erie County Prison for longer-term detention, depending on their case.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long do inmates typically stay at Millcreek Township Police Jail?

Stays at this facility are usually short-term, typically lasting no more than 72 hours. Inmates requiring longer detention are generally transferred to Erie County Prison.

Can I post bail at Millcreek Township Police Jail?

Yes, bail can typically be posted at this facility. Contact the jail directly for specific instructions and accepted payment methods.

What items are inmates allowed to have at this facility?

Due to the short-term nature of stays, personal items are generally not permitted. Essential medical items may be allowed with approval from jail staff.
